UNIT 2 “My Body”
There were seven activities in unit 2. The first activities were opening daily routines by sing a song and checking the attendance. The followed by
introducing the new theme of the body parts. The next activity was introducing the vocabulary about parts of the body by asking to point and say. Then, the
teacher and children discussed the materials by using pictures of body parts. The children also ask to match in the activity four listen and circle.
In the next activities were follow up activities. The children were asked to sing a song then demonstrated it by themselves. Then, the activities were
identifying the body parts of the children. They also asked to match the pictures
by cycling the words. The last was played a game of action chain. The review was the last activities. The aim of these tasks was to check the understanding of the
children about the learning process. 3
Unit 3 “ My Family”
There were seven activities in this unit. As the unit one and two, the first activities in this unit also opening daily routines by sing a song and checking
the attendance. Then continue to the introducing the new theme of family members by using pictures and flash cards. The children were asked to pointing
out the pictures of the parts of the body. The next first activities to make children interested in learning. They were asking for listening and repeating the words. The
role play of family members also played. The next activities were discussing the family tree. Continued to the others activities, the children were asked to paste the
photo of their family member in the developed worksheet. In the follow up activities, the children were asked to sing a song
“Where is Father?”. After that, they were asked to demonstrate the song by themselves. Then, the next activity was playing a game of
“Happy family” game. The last activities were the review. This activity used to assess the children’s
understanding after the teaching and learning process.
